Engineered siding installation services involve attaching specially designed siding materials to the exterior of a property to enhance its appearance and durability. These services typically include the careful measurement, preparation, and precise fitting of engineered siding products, ensuring a seamless and secure fit. Professionals often handle surface preparation, such as removing old siding or repairing underlying structures, to provide a clean foundation for the new siding. The process may also involve sealing joints and applying finishing touches to improve the overall aesthetic and protect the building against weather elements.
One of the primary benefits of engineered siding installation is its ability to address common exterior problems. It helps improve energy efficiency by providing an additional layer of insulation, which can reduce heating and cooling costs. Additionally, engineered siding offers a protective barrier that resists moisture, pests, and decay, thereby minimizing issues like wood rot, mold growth, or insect infestation. Proper installation also prevents issues related to warping, cracking, or detachment that can occur with poorly fitted or aging siding materials.

Material Costs - Engineered siding installation typically ranges from $3 to $7 per square foot, depending on the type of material selected. For example, vinyl-based engineered siding may cost around $3 to $4 per square foot, while more premium options could be closer to $6 or $7.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ing engineered siding generally fall between $2 and $5 per square foot. The total labor fee can vary based on the complexity of the project and the local contractor rates in Shrewsbury, MA.
Project Size Impact - Larger siding projects often benefit from lower per-square-foot costs, with total expenses ranging from $4,000 to $15,000 for typical residential homes. Smaller jobs may start around $2,500, depending on the scope and materials used.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as removal of existing siding or repairs can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all project. These costs vary based on the condition of the existing structure and specific site requ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
